Cleaning up my Howell Research

Howell-Darling Research
By Don Taylor

I recently discovered several death certificates, which I had downloaded in 2015, related to my wife’s Howell family line but were overlooked. This collection included a mix of processed, unexamined, and partially extracted documents for the Howell-Darling family tree.

Document Processing

Over the course of a few days, I accomplished the following tasks:

  1. Extracted and incorporated data from over 30 death certificates and records.
  2. Repaired 38 broken citations.
  3. Removed six duplicate entries.
  4. I added 45 new individuals to my family tree.

Individuals Covered

The death certificates and records pertained to various family members, including:

  • Howell family members (e.g., Anna Lee Howell Boseman, Ashley Long Howell, David Bushrod Howell, Peter Fletcher Howell)
  • Hobbs and Vincent relatives (e.g., Annie Hobbs Armstrong, Barkett Vincent, Benjamin J. Vincent)
  • Long family members (e.g., Benjamin Lafayette Long & Joseph John Long)
  • Other connected individuals (e.g., Bessie Johnson Tippett, Hazel Valentine, William A Merritt)

Outcome

This thorough review and organization of documents has significantly improved the accuracy and completeness of my Howell-Darling family tree. All document images are now available in my Ancestry Family Tree for future reference.
